The Importance of Planning
Effective planning is crucial for any digital nomad, particularly when traveling during holidays. Start by creating a comprehensive itinerary for your intended travel destinations. This should include flight schedules, accommodation arrangements, and a work schedule that accommodates time zones and deadlines. Consider blocking out specific times for work and leisure to ensure balance. Utilize digital tools such as Google Calendar or project management software to keep track of tasks and deadlines, ensuring that work responsibilities are not neglected while you explore new environments.

Choosing the Right Destinations
When planning your holiday travels, consider destinations that are not only appealing but also conducive to remote work. Look for places with reliable internet access, co-working spaces, and a supportive environment for remote professionals. Cities with a thriving digital nomad community can provide opportunities for networking and collaboration, making it easier to balance work and leisure. Additionally, choosing destinations that offer cultural experiences or holiday festivities can enrich your travel experience while still allowing you the ability to meet your work commitments.
Utilizing Flexible Work Hours
Digital nomads often have the flexibility to choose their working hours, which can be a significant advantage during the holiday season. Take advantage of this flexibility by adjusting your work schedule to align with the holiday festivities. For instance, work during the early morning hours when distractions are minimal, allowing you to free up your afternoons and evenings for holiday activities and gatherings. This adaptability can provide a more enjoyable holiday experience while ensuring that your professional responsibilities are still met.
Staying Productive While Traveling
To maintain productivity while traveling, create a dedicated workspace in your accommodations, whether it's a rented apartment, hotel room, or a co-working space. A well-organized workspace can minimize distractions and help you focus during working hours. Additionally, establish a routine that incorporates regular breaks and time for relaxation, which is especially important during the often hectic holiday season. Consider using productivity techniques such as the Pomodoro Technique, where you work in short bursts followed by brief breaks, to maintain focus and efficiency.
Maintaining Communication
Clear communication with your team, clients, and contacts is vital for digital nomads, especially during the holidays. Inform your colleagues about your travel plans and any changes in your availability ahead of time. Utilize communication tools such as Slack, Zoom, or project management platforms to stay connected and updated on work projects. Planning and informing others of your schedule can prevent misunderstandings and facilitate smoother collaborations, allowing you to focus on both work and travel.
